Guided nature-cultural walk to the Third Altar with Asiago Guide
Sunday 15 August 2021 from 9.30 to 12.30
Destination: Stuttgart – Asiago Plateau and the Seven Municipalities (VI)
Starting from Stuttgart, we begin a walk through the streets of the characteristic mountain village, where time seems to have stopped, and then continue through the meadows and woods of the Col d'Ecchele,one of the many battlefields of the First World War where the gold medalist Roberto Sarfatti fell.
From here we will descend towards the Valsugana,where strange karst formations watch over the valley like sentinels, the last of these columns is the Spitzknotto,a place full of mystery, sacred to the first inhabitants of these mountains.
Also known by the name of Third Altar,this formation overlooking the Val Frenzela, has always enchant the imagination of the inhabitants. The guide will accompany you to discover the history and legends of the area to spend a pleasant morning breathing the healthy mountain air.

DIFFICULTYà: we assign a difficulty 1 on a scale from 3 (very easy) to 5 (challenging).
The route is a ring and does not present technical difficulties. It develops between mountain paths and dirt roads. The difference in height uphill is less than 300 m.
TO TAKE WITH YOU:mountain boots, layered clothing suitable for the mountain climate, waterproof jacket, water for the duration of the trip (at least 1 liter).
